About Numeris:Numeris (is a specialist financial modelling and valuation firm focused on enabling better decision-making for impactful transactions across Africa. The firm was launched in 2024 but we are growing fast. Our mission is to drive impactful change by serving companies that contribute positively to the continent's development (from early-stage start-ups to mature corporates). We believe in delivering high-quality, unbiased advice and remain committed to transparency and affordability in our pricing structure.
